HPA axis dysregulation refers to an imbalance in the normal functioning of the hypothalamic–pituitary–adrenal axis, the system responsible for managing the body’s stress response. Under healthy conditions, the HPA axis releases stress hormones like cortisol in a balanced, rhythmic way to help the body adapt to challenges. However, prolonged physical or emotional stress can disrupt this process, leading to HPA axis dysregulation. When this occurs, cortisol levels may become too high, too low, or poorly timed throughout the day. As a result, individuals may experience fatigue, sleep disturbances, mood changes, difficulty concentrating, weakened immunity, and reduced stress tolerance. Addressing lifestyle factors such as sleep quality, nutrition, and stress management can help support recovery from HPA axis dysregulation and restore hormonal balance.
